Contech startup Xpanner raises KRW 6 billion in Series A funding
Reading Time: 2 minutesKorea-based con-tech startup Xpanner has raised KRW 6 billion in Series A funding from Korea Investment Partners, KB Investment, and others.
Xpanner is preparing the construction machinery automation solution ‘Mango’ and is discovering smart construction solutions necessary for digital transformation of construction sites and supplying them on-site customized.
Last year, the company delivered smart construction solutions such as BIM (Building Information Modeling) based integrated control system to five construction sites. Based on construction machinery equipped with advanced robotics and sensors such as machine guidance and tiltrotators, the company has introduced a Nordic model for improving productivity and control efficiency in Korea.
In November last year, the company established a North American subsidiary and is expanding overseas. The company has also signed partnerships with companies that are engaged in construction technology or equipment-related businesses in North America, such as Geotab and PIRTEK. The company will also partner with domestic and foreign companies that provide smart construction solutions, such as Infrakit, MOBA, and JK, in North America. The company has also been selected as a global member of Shinhan Square Bridge Incheon, a startup incubation program, to accelerate its overseas expansion.
Xpanner’s potential and business performance have also been recognized at home and abroad. In April 2022, the company was selected as one of the top 50 startups in the construction equipment operation management sector by Built Worlds, the world’s largest construction-related conference, in the United States.
In December 2022, the company participated in the launching ceremony of the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, and Transport’s ‘One Team Korea’ overseas construction order support team. Since then, the company has strengthened its network with related ministries, large companies, and startups, leading to substantial overseas expansion results. Currently, the company is in discussions with several construction companies ranked within the top 10 in Korea’s construction capability assessment to collaborate on more than four sites in North America and the Middle East.
“Xpanner’s automation solution was developed by members of major manufacturers such as Volvo, Doosan, and Bobcat, and is already applied to many sites, so it has considerable credibility,” said Park Sang-jun, a director at Korea Investment Partners. “We expect that Xpanner will be able to achieve an exceptional level of corporate value for a startup in the con-tech sector that is unfamiliar in Korea.”
Meanwhile, Xpanner, which was founded in May 2020, has exceeded KRW 9 billion in cumulative sales to date. Cumulative investments totaled more than 8 billion won.
